Topics Covered
- 1. Introduction to Machine Learning for Return Processes: Learners will understand the basics of machine learning, including types of learning algorithms, and how they can be applied to automate return processes. They will gain foundational skills in data preprocessing and feature selection.
- 2. Data Collection and Preparation for Return Processes: This module covers the techniques for collecting and preparing data specific to return processes, including handling missing values, outliers, and normalization. Learners will become proficient in using Python libraries for data manipulation.
- 3. Supervised Learning for Classification in Returns: Learners will study supervised learning techniques, focusing on classification tasks for return processes. They will learn to implement and evaluate models using common algorithms like logistic regression, decision trees, and random forests.
- 4. Unsupervised Learning for Clustering Returns: This module introduces unsupervised learning, particularly clustering techniques, to segment returns data into meaningful groups. Learners will practice implementing clustering algorithms and interpreting the results.
- 5. Recommendation Systems for Predicting Returns: Learners will explore recommendation systems and how they can predict future returns based on historical data. They will gain hands-on experience in building and tuning recommendation models.
- 6. Natural Language Processing for Return Reason Analysis: This module covers natural language processing (NLP) techniques to analyze return reasons extracted from customer feedback. Learners will learn to preprocess text data and apply NLP models for sentiment analysis and topic modeling.
- 7. Time Series Analysis for Forecasting Return Trends: Learners will study time series analysis techniques to forecast future return trends. They will practice using ARIMA and other time series models to develop accurate predictions.
- 8. Automation of Return Process Workflows: This module focuses on integrating machine learning models into return process workflows. Learners will learn to design and implement automated systems for processing returns more efficiently.
- 9. Model Evaluation and Deployment: Learners will learn how to evaluate machine learning models using appropriate metrics and techniques. They will also gain experience in deploying models into production environments, ensuring they are robust and scalable.
- 10. Advanced Topics in Return Process Automation: This final module covers advanced topics like ensemble methods, deep learning, and reinforcement learning in the context of return process automation. Learners will explore cutting-edge techniques and their applications.
